#bb809d color RGB value is (187,128,157). #bb809d color name is Custom Color color.
#bb809d hex color red value is 187, green value is 128 and the blue value of its RGB is 157.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#bb809d hue: 0.92, saturation: 0.30 and the lightness value of bb809d is 0.62.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#bb809d color hex is 0.00, 0.32, 0.16, 0.27. Web safe color of #bb809d is #cc9999. Color #bb809d contains mainly PINK color.

About #BB809D Custom Color
#BB809D (Custom Color) is a pink-based color with RGB values of 187, 128, 157. This color belongs to the pink color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#bb809d,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#bb809d can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#bb809d), RGB (rgb(187, 128, 157)), HSL (hsl(331, 30%, 62%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cc9999,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
